| | 231bex wrote: | | Hi all, just been having a look in our emp tank and there a loads of baby crickets in there... Is this a problem should I try and get them out? We don't leave food in for Long if it's not eaten so am suprised this has happened cricket must of layed quick! |
It might turn into a problem(it did for me) so, if you can easily get them out then do so,otherwise; get out as many as you can and hope the rest eventually get eaten.When feeding adult female crickets it is best to maim them first so they can't lay eggs. |
